Civil war declared as Chad Bianco torches Republican gubernatorial rival Steve Hilton, despite lagging in the polls

A bitter GOP civil war is erupting in California’s governor race with Riverside County Sheriff Chad Bianco torching Republican rival Steve Hilton’s campaign as a “full-blown lie” and claiming he’s been “bought and paid for” by Democrats.In a blistering video message Tuesday, Bianco flatly demanded Hilton quit the race as the two Republicans battle to survive California’s jungle primary system and snag a spot in November’s general election.“Hey Steve, it’s Riverside County Sheriff Chad Bianco, your next governor.Steve, it is time for you to drop out.
Your campaign has already failed,” Bianco said.“It failed in January.You ran out of money last month.
You are now being propped up and funded by Democrats.”The sheriff accused Democratic operatives and super PACs of quietly boosting Hilton because they see the former Fox News host as an easier opponent than the tough-talking lawman.“Democrats and Democrat super PACs are spending a fortune running your campaign,” Bianco charged.Bianco also revived attacks tied to reports involving Hilton’s name appearing in documents connected to deceased sex offender Jeffrey Epstein.California's top news, sports and entertainment delivered to your inbox every day.
